Analysis
In 2024, school enrollment, secondary, female in Turks and Caicos Islands stood at 112.6%. That is the highest value across all 21 years on record.
The figure is up 10.7% on the previous year and up 60.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, school enrollment, secondary, female in Turks and Caicos Islands peaked at 112.6%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 49.9%, in 1973.
That places Turks and Caicos Islands 23rd out of 202 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 21 years of available data.
School enrollment, secondary, female in Turks and Caicos Islands, year by year
| Year | % gross |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1973 | 49.9% | — |
| 1974 | 52.5% | +5.2% |
| 1978 | 86.7% | +65.2% |
| 1994 | 89.0% | +2.7% |
| 1999 | 86.7% | -2.6% |
| 2000 | 83.0% | -4.3% |
| 2003 | 80.0% | -3.6% |
| 2004 | 85.6% | +7.0% |
| 2005 | 93.9% | +9.8% |
| 2009 | 107.7% | +14.7% |
| 2014 | 70.4% | -34.7% |
| 2015 | 78.5% | +11.5% |
| 2016 | 69.3% | -11.7% |
| 2017 | 80.8% | +16.6% |
| 2018 | 86.9% | +7.5% |
| 2019 | 83.3% | -4.0% |
| 2020 | 81.3% | -2.5% |
| 2021 | 88.0% | +8.2% |
| 2022 | 95.5% | +8.6% |
| 2023 | 101.7% | +6.5% |
| 2024 | 112.6% | +10.7% |

About this data
Gross enrollment ratio is the ratio of total enrollment, regardless of age, to the population of the age group that officially corresponds to the level of education shown. Secondary education completes the provision of basic education that began at the primary level, and aims at laying the foundations for lifelong learning and human development, by offering more subject- or skill-oriented instruction using more specialized teachers.
